New Features
One of the best new features is the full screen browser. To enable it, open your browser and go to settings, then Labs, then check the quick controls box.
Now if you want to access any buttons or controls in your browser, simply drag your finger in from the left or right side of the screen and a menu wheel will come up.
Really neat browsing experience. - 06-01-2011, 06:32 PM #7
